PTO Meeting Update
- The ice rink is up and running! Students may skate during recess if there is adult supervision. If you would like to help, please contact the school office. Students should bring their own skates and skate guards. Helmets are encouraged. The rink maintenance is funded by the PTO.
- On Jan. 31 from 9-10 a.m., there will be coffee and donuts for those parents or guardians who would like to meet with Principal Nick Straw and ask questions. The refreshments are sponsored by the PTO.
- Our school provided holiday gifts and food to seven Gladys Wood families in need. All of the donations were covered by GW staff, families, School Business Partners and other anonymous donors. Nurse Kathy reported it was wonderful to be able to do this for our families and they were very thankful.
- The Sport-a-Thon is our school's second big fundraiser of the year (in addition to the Read-a-Thon). The activities will kick off on Feb. 7 during the school day. There will be a family skate night that evening. Parents can also learn more about the Sport-A-Thon during skate night.
- 6th grade fundraising continues for the end-of-year activities. Fundraising is on target so that the fun day will be of no cost to 6th-grade families.
- The March family night is tentatively scheduled for March 20 to be a multicultural event.
The next general PTO meeting is scheduled for 5:30 p.m. on Feb. 4. We value participants' time and will limit the meeting to 1 hour or less. Childcare is provided free of charge.
